Vertical Aerospace ( (EVTL) ) has issued an announcement.
On May 12, 2025, Vertical Aerospace announced the development of a hybrid-electric VTOL variant of its VX4 aircraft, aimed at expanding range and payload capabilities to tap into new market opportunities within the urban air mobility sector. This new variant, which builds on the company’s all-electric VX4, is expected to commence flight testing in Q2 2026 and is targeted for certification by 2028. The hybrid-electric VTOL is designed to serve defense, logistics, and commercial sectors, with capabilities such as a range of up to 1,000 miles and payload capacity of up to 1,100 kilograms. Vertical Aerospace is positioning itself to capture a significant share of the global market with this scalable and exportable offering, leveraging its proprietary battery technology and advanced control systems to meet stringent safety standards.

More about Vertical Aerospace
Vertical Aerospace is a global aerospace and technology company pioneering electric aviation. The company is focused on creating safer, cleaner, and quieter travel solutions through its Electric Vertical Take-Off and Landing (eVTOL) aircraft, the VX4, which is a piloted, four-passenger aircraft with zero operating emissions. Vertical Aerospace collaborates with leading aerospace companies and develops proprietary battery and propeller technology to advance eVTOL capabilities. The company has approximately 1,500 pre-orders for the VX4 from customers across four continents, including major airlines such as American Airlines and Japan Airlines.
